Transaction 7860f690eaabddf318bd49bad95a268f4a0480764013d65b01c508410a314f61
1 Input
1 Output
-
7860f690eaabddf318bd49bad95a268f4a0480764013d65b01c508410a314f61:0
- value
- 127230000
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 8278b52da3b8f17fc72dabac976d05aa61bb3d6b OP_EQUALVERIFY OP_CHECKSIG
- address
- 1CtsSrkzUMEw29CuTiF5GomHZKR22YT6pV